Tecumseh HSK60 Snow King Fuel Leak
Original Message   Dec 7, 2007 6:43 pm
Getting my snow thrower ready for the first predicted snow, I filled the tank with fresh gasoline and it started immediately running out thru the hole in the primer bulb.  I've replaced the primer bulb but it didn't fix the problem..  Any idea how this is happening and what can be done to fix. Re: Tecumseh HSK60 Snow King Fuel Leak
Reply #1   Dec 7, 2007 7:03 pm
float isnt closing off fuel flow. bad float, improper float setting, bad needle or seat. only things that would cause this............. DI
